Schizo is a typical Pete Walker (Frightmare, House Of Whipcord, The Comeback) film - cheaply made, lots of gore and very enjoyable. Schizo was released in 1976 (they new how to make decent horror films in the 70's) and concerns a young woman Samantha (Lynn Frederick) who witnessed her mother's murder when she was a child.

Sybil is a 1976 two-part, 3 + 1 ⁄ 4-hour American made-for-television film starring Sally Field and Joanne Woodward. It is based on the book of the same name , and it was broadcast on NBC on November 14–15, 1976.
